2022 Heart Failure Summit
Heart failure is a chronic progressive disease with over 6.5 million Americans affected, and researchers expect the number to increase to 8 million by the year 2030. Nearly all heart failure patients will have at least one hospitalization during their disease and one in four patients face readmission within 30 days of discharge. In this complicated disease, there is nearly a 40% mortality rate within a year of their first hospitalization, taking a tremendous toll on the quality of life for patients, families, and caregivers.
